The more I looked at TermMax, the less I think fixed rates are the real story. The real shift may be what happens to leverage when the cost of borrowing is known before the position even starts. In most DeFi lending markets, you are managing two moving parts at once: the price of your collateral and the cost of keeping the position open. If borrowing rates suddenly move, a position that looked reasonable at entry can become much harder to maintain. That is where @termmax gets interesting. Borrowing cost can be fixed until maturity. That does not remove liquidation risk. It does not remove market risk. But it does remove one moving variable from the calculation. And I think that matters more than most people realize. Predictable financing changes how a position can be planned. Instead of entering and hoping borrowing conditions stay favorable, the financing cost can be estimated beforehand. For larger positions, funds and structured strategies, that may eventually matter more than simply finding the cheapest rate available today. That is why I am starting to see TermMax less as another lending market and more as infrastructure for making onchain credit easier to plan around. The question I keep coming back to: Does fixed cost make onchain leverage genuinely easier to manage, or does it simply make the risk easier to calculate? #TermMax $TMX

@Dusk_Foundation $DUSK #dusk I think one of the biggest misunderstandings around tokenization is that putting an asset onchain automatically creates liquidity. While reading Dusk’s latest research, one thing caught my attention. Dusk itself makes it clear that tokenization does not create buyers, fair pricing or a liquid secondary market by itself. That made me look at the project differently. The real challenge is not just creating a token. It is connecting the full lifecycle of a regulated security, from investor eligibility and issuance to ownership records, settlement and secondary trading. This is where the difference between tokenization and native issuance becomes important. A tokenized security can still depend on an offchain system as the real ownership record. That means reconciliation is still needed. With native issuance, the security can be created, transferred, serviced and settled around the ledger from the beginning. To me, that is a much bigger idea than simply putting an existing asset onchain. Dusk is building around this with DuskDS for settlement and finality, Dusk Trade for regulated asset access and trading, and privacy tools designed to reveal required information without exposing everything else. What I also like is that Dusk does not pretend blockchain can solve everything. It cannot create demand, guarantee liquidity or replace regulation. So I am not watching how many assets Dusk can tokenize. I am watching how much of a real security’s lifecycle can actually move onto Dusk while privacy, compliance and settlement still work properly. That could separate an RWA narrative from financial infrastructure. Research only. Not financial advice.

Everyone is watching @termmax for the $TMX TGE. I studied the machine behind the token and found a much bigger story. TermMax reports $90M+ TVL, 1.5M+ registered wallets, 90K+ daily active users and deployment across 10 EVM chains. Meanwhile, DeFiLlama currently tracks $31.26M TVL plus $27.22M in active loans. Different measurement lenses but one clear conclusion: this is not a token still searching for a product. TermMax V2 already brings multichain markets into one view, combines liquidity sources for better execution and lets both lenders and borrowers place limit orders. Now $TMX enters with a fixed 1B supply, staking, governance, and utility for curators and market creation. The protocol also reports a 93% DeFiSafety score, public audits and an Immunefi bug bounty. That is why August 25 matters. Not because another ticker goes live but because an operating fixed-rate credit system gains its economic coordination layer. The real post-TGE test: do active loans, fees and repeat users continue growing? Would you trade the launch or track the system? #TermMax Research only. Not financial advice.

The Dusk story gets much stronger when you stop looking at it as “just another tokenization project.” What caught my attention is that @Dusk_Foundation is building across multiple layers of the stack. At the infrastructure level, Dusk is pushing the idea of native issuance not simply wrapping an existing asset into a token, but creating a framework where issuance, ownership, transfer and settlement can all live directly on-chain. At the application level, Dusk Trade makes that vision more practical. It is designed around regulated financial assets and the kind of market structure traditional finance actually needs, rather than generic crypto speculation. Then there is the token itself. $DUSK is not just there for branding. It has direct network utility through gas and staking. Gas powers activity on the network, while staking helps secure it and supports participation in consensus. That gives the token a clearer role inside the ecosystem. What makes this interesting to me is the combination: privacy + compliance + regulated assets + real token utility A lot of projects talk about bringing real-world assets on-chain. Dusk seems to be asking a more serious question: What if the full lifecycle of regulated digital assets could be issued, traded, settled and secured in one purpose-built environment? That is why Dusk feels like a deeper infrastructure play than most people first assume. #dusk $DUSK {future}(DUSKUSDT)
